Bar-coding Process at a Food Container Manufacturing

Company
Bar-coding has been implemented at the Food Container Manufacturing
Company to maintain traceability of the product even after it has been sold
Process Overview

Bar code consist of 10 digit serial numbers


Bar code is printed
Printed Bar Code issued to the Production shop floor
Bar code is linked to the production order and other characteristics in the
Barcode system
Bar code is applied on the Finished products
Bar code on finished product is scanned at the finished of production line.
The scanned bar code is uploaded into SAP against the Production order and
production order confirmation is done for the number of scanned products
Subsequently the product is traced through the bar code as it moves through
dispatch
When a customer complaint comes in the production order/batch is traced by
scanning the bar code on the product. This ensures traceability of the
finished product to the production order and the batch and in turns the raw
materials used in the batch
